Overview

The Oklahoma State University Center for Research on Teaching and Learning (CRSTL) invites upper elementary and middle school students to take their coding skills to the next level at KIDS Advanced Coding Camp. Designed for students entering grades 5–7, this afternoon session builds on foundational programming knowledge and introduces campers to Python, one of today’s most widely used coding languages.


Campers will also work with Edison robots and participate in small group activities that promote team building, critical thinking, and creative problem solving. This interactive, hands-on camp provides the perfect environment for budding coders to sharpen their skills and explore more advanced concepts in a supportive and engaging setting.


Camp runs from 12:30 p.m. to 3:30 p.m. daily and includes a T-shirt and snack. Space is limited to 24 participants, so early registration is recommended.
